Web4.3.1 Binary Phase Shift Keying. For binary phase shift keying (BPSK), we transmit two different signals. If the baseband signal is a binary 0, we transmit: BPSK can be considered as a form of amplitude shift keying where each nonreturn to zero (NRZ) data bit of value 0 is mapped into a −1, and each NRZ 1 is mapped into a + 1. WebThe term BPSK stands for Binary Phase-Shift Keying. Sometimes, it is also called as PRK (phase reversal keying) or 2PSK. This kind of phase-shift keying utilizes 2-phases which are separated with 180 degrees. So …

WebApr 12, 2024 · PSK is a modulation scheme that changes the phase of the carrier signal according to the information bits. For example, binary PSK (BPSK) uses two phases, 0 and 180 degrees, to represent 0 and 1. WebMay 22, 2024 · A binary PSK modulation system is shown in Figure \(\PageIndex{2}\) where the binary input data causes \(180^{\circ}\) phase changes of the carrier.
